PACKAGE WITH OPPOSING LOCKING MECHANISMS
20220363455 · 2022-11-17 ·

The package includes a base, a primary lid connected to the base via a first hinge, the primary lid and the base defining a primary storage area when the primary lid is in a closed position, a first locking mechanism, and a second locking mechanism. The first locking mechanism and the second locking mechanism each include a flexible member including a first and second segment connected by an elbow, the first segment being connected to the primary lid, a distal end of the second segment including a contact structure, the second segment including a first engaging structure, a second engaging structure on an interior wall of the base, the flexible member being in a first position when the primary lid is in the closed position, the second engaging structure being retained by the first engaging structure to lock the primary lid onto the base in the closed position.

AN ATTACHABLE REFUSE DISPOSAL RECEPTACLE
20230101645 · 2023-03-30 ·

One or more embodiments are disclosed of a receptacle for collecting inedible food items discarded by spitting, such popcorn husks and seed shells. The receptacle comprises a receiving unit that has a upper end depending downward toward a collection unit and may generally have a funnel like shape. The receiving unit is configured to contain an act of spitting out inedible bits of food by an individual, making it more discrete and preventing the spread of germs. The collection unit is connected to the lower end of the receiving unit. The collection unit may include a closed end or an end that is closed by a connectable cap. The receptacle can be provided in bag having an adhesive backing that can adhere to a container, or in an alternate embodiment, the receptacle includes an attachment piece that can hook onto a lip of the container.

Floss cup
11612464 · 2023-03-28 ·

A portable floss cup that allows for quick and convenient access to un-used portable flossers is provided. The floss cup is sized to fit in the cup holder of one's vehicle, and may be composed of paper, plastic, or biodegradable materials. The cup is formed with an inner wall for receiving used portable flossers and waste therein, an outer wall having a diameter larger than the inner wall, and an upper wall extending between the inner and outer wall. Un-used portable flossers are radially disposed in slots provided around the upper wall. A lid large enough to cover the top of the cup may also be included. Once the flossers provided with the cup are expended, an end user may either replace the expended flossers with new un-used ones, or they may replace the cup entirely.

Cigarette butt holding container
11470877 · 2022-10-18 ·

A cigarette butt holding tube including a tube assembly, lid assembly, and a cigarette pack assembly is disclosed. These assemblies in conjunction with one another provide an easy-to-use cigarette butt disposal solution to help reduce littering. The cigarette pack assembly includes a spacing within the cigarette pack for a tube of the tube assembly to be received therein. The tube includes a tube opening at a top end that is larger than the width of a cigarette butt. The tube is selectively sealed by a lid of the lid assembly. Once a user is finished smoking a cigarette, the used cigarette butt can be conveniently disposed of and sealed within the tube. The tube being smell proof, fireproof, and fire resistant prevents the smell of smoke within the cigarette pack. The tube also prevents a still lit cigarette butt from setting fire to the remaining cigarettes.

Seed Container and Shell Receptacle
20170313463 · 2017-11-02 ·

A seed container and shell receptacle for separately storing fresh and used seeds. The seed container and shell receptacle includes an outer container having at least one sidewall, an open upper end, and a removably securable base defining an interior outer volume. An inner container having at least one sidewall, an open top end, and an open bottom end nests within the outer container such that the base of the outer container acts as the inner container's base defining an interior inner volume. A lid is removably securable to the open upper end of the outer container and includes a first and second aperture giving access to the interior outer volume and interior inner volume, respectively. The first and second apertures can be sealed by a first and second sealing mechanism respectively.

Method and Apparatus for Storage and Delivery of Test Strips
20220153506 · 2022-05-19 ·

An easy to use, low-cost dispenser container delivers individual test strips ready for insertion into a glucometer without requiring extraction of individual strips manually from the package. The system may provide a dry, contaminant-free, storage device whereby stored strips are not repeatedly exposed to humidity. As each strip is removed from the device, a gasket seals the storage, Desiccants may be used to maintain the integrity of the storage environment. A convenient built-in waste receptacle for used strips may include a mechanical means for removing the used strips from the glucometer without the need for touching the bloodied end of the used strips.
